SPINDEX, Explained 📊
MLTT is thrilled to launch its own ratings system for this season and beyond!
Introducing The Standardized Pong Index Rating — or SPINDEX — System, which estimates a player’s skill level on a scale from 0 to 3000.
Here’s how it works: In each singles match, the winner and loser exchange points based on their relative ratings. For example, if a player with a 2500 rating competes against a player with a 2400 rating, the higher-rated player is expected to win, and 6 points will be exchanged if they do. However, if the 2500-rated player loses to the lower-rated 2400 player, which is less likely, the point exchange would be 22.
Players who have been inactive for over a year will have their rating reduced by 25 points every three months.

MLTT Around the Globe 🗺
How did other MLTT players fare in their off-week competitions? Here’s a quick round-up of our standouts from matches around the world:
➡️ Texas Smash star Amy Wang (MLTT No. 14, SPINDEX 2600) took home a bronze medal in both the Women’s Singles and the Mixed Doubles at the ITTF Pan American Championships in San Salvador. (photo above via @usatabletennis/IG)
➡️ Princeton Revolution star Jishan Liang (MLTT No. 28, SPINDEX 2704) was Amy Wang’s Mixed Doubles partner and won a Bronze medal in San Salvador.
➡️ Seattle Spinners star Olajide Omotayo (MLTT No. 7, SPINDEX 2640) helped lead Nigeria to a spot in the men’s doubles finals at the 2024 ITTF Africa Senior Championships in Addis Ababa, Ethiopia.
➡️ Ľubomír Pištej of the Seattle Spinners (MLTT No. 20, SPINDEX 2686), Liam Pitchford of the Florida Crocs (MLTT No. 9, SPINDEX 2868), and Benedek Olah of the Princeton Revolution (MLTT No. 19, SPINDEX 2723) all made it to the Round of 32 in the 2024 ETTU Championships held in Linz, Austria.
